About Lima East

Lima East is a small rural locality in north-east Victoria, situated within Benalla Rural City approximately 147 kilometres north-east of Melbourne. Covering around 54.5 square kilometres of mixed farmland, the locality sits in the foothill country south of Benalla, part of the broader Lima district known historically for dairying and mixed agriculture. With a 2021 Census population of 165, Lima East is a sparsely populated farming community.

The locality and surrounding Lima district developed as a dairying region, with local farmers also carrying on mixed farming including beef cattle. Residents travel to Benalla or Wangaratta for everyday services, schools, and shopping. The rugged ranges and farmland of the Ovens Valley region to the east offer scenic landscapes and opportunities for rural lifestyle properties, attracting those seeking a quieter existence away from the city.

What is Lima East known for? +

Lima East is known as part of the historic Lima farming district of north-east Victoria, where dairying and mixed farming have been the mainstay since the late 1800s. The locality offers a quiet rural lifestyle amid the foothills and pastoral country south of Benalla.

How far is Lima East from Melbourne? +

Lima East is approximately 147 kilometres north-east of Melbourne, making it roughly a 1.5 to 2 hour drive via the Hume Freeway. The town of Benalla, approximately 25 kilometres away, is the nearest major service centre.

Does Lima East have public transport? +

Lima East has no public transport services. The nearest train station is Benalla, approximately 25 kilometres away, on the North East Line connecting Melbourne with Albury. A car is essential for residents.
